Description In an undead world, death is only one mistake away.
How does one survive the zombie apocalypse? 17-year-old Ian Ward couldn't tell you because he is dying in one.
From a closet in a second floor bedroom of an abandoned house, he recounts his tale of survival in a backwards journey through the choices that put him there.
When the world ends, Mistakes I Made During the Zombie Apocalypse is the anti-survival guide that just might keep you alive.

When she is not writing, she enjoys hiking and camping, playing guitar, lifting weights, dressing up in full gore to attend zombie-related events, web design, and gaming.
Her writing portfolio includes the novel When the Dead, the novel The Spread: A Zombie Short Story Collection, a writing collection entitled Last Night While You Were Sleeping, and the reverse chronologically told Mistakes I Made During the Zombie Apocalypse.
Several of her short stories can be found in other books including Roms, Bombs, and Zoms from Evil Girlfriend Media and A Very Zombie Christmas from ATZ Publications.
After many adventures, she currently lives with a broken heart, her twin sister, two attack cats, and a fear of the dark.
